Housing Benefit and Universal Credit Housing Element

Housing support remains vital for many low-income households across the UK. Those receiving Housing Benefit through local councils will get payments either every two or four weeks, depending on their arrangement. If you’re on Universal Credit, your housing element is included in your monthly Universal Credit payment.

To avoid delays, ensure that your rent information and tenancy details are up to date in your council or Universal Credit account, especially if you’ve had recent changes in your living situation or income.

Child Benefit and June 2025 Payment Cycles

Child Benefit will continue to be paid every four weeks, typically falling on Mondays or Tuesdays. For June 2025, expected payment dates are the 2nd, 9th, 16th, 23rd, and 30th. Parents and guardians should ensure that their details remain current to avoid any disruption.

For households where one parent earns over £50,000 annually, the High Income Child Benefit Charge (HICBC) still applies. It’s important to account for this when planning finances, as some or all of the benefit may need to be repaid through Self Assessment.

WASPI Women: Current Status as of May 2025

The campaign for justice by WASPI (Women Against State Pension Inequality) women continues into mid-2025. These women, born in the 1950s, were affected by changes to the State Pension age without proper notice. Discussions between advocacy groups and government representatives are ongoing.

While no formal compensation scheme has been finalised yet, reports suggest that DWP is preparing a potential framework depending on the Parliamentary Ombudsman’s ruling. WASPI campaigners are pushing for clear timelines and resolutions as soon as possible.
